Funeral Industry Information Sessions​

If you have always wanted to find out more about working in the Funeral Industry, we invite you behind the scenes with us to discover what it is like to be a Funeral Industry Professional.

Learn more about this very rewarding role and the various duties we perform in assisting our clients to create meaningful funeral experiences.

We run these sessions periodically to help those who are interested in working in the funeral industry gain invaluable insight and first-hand information.

Founded in 1934

The first funeral conducted by Tobin Brothers Funerals was for Ena Margaret Price in 1934. In its first year, the company conducted 53 funerals and after the payment of creditors and the collection of debts, it made a modest profit.
